Arabic Tashkeel Remover

Remove short vowels, shadda, tanween, and other diacritics (tashkeel) from Arabic text instantly in your browser.

How to use Arabic Tashkeel Remover

  1. Paste your Arabic text with diacritics into the input box.
  2. Toggle whether to keep Shadda or Tanween marks.
  3. Click the 'Remove Arabic Diacritics' button.
  4. Copy or download the clean text.

This free online utility strips Arabic diacritics (tashkeel/harakat) from text. You can choose to keep the shadda (double consonant marker) or tanween depending on your normalization requirements. The entire process runs client-side in Javascript, meaning your text never leaves your browser.

FAQ

What is Arabic Tashkeel?
Tashkeel (harakat) are phonetic diacritic marks placed above or below Arabic letters to denote short vowel sounds and pronunciation guides.
Does my text get uploaded to any servers?
No. The diacritics removal is computed locally in your web browser using JavaScript regex matching. Your text is kept completely private.
